(Makes approximately 2 cups)
Ingredients
1 cup chopped blueberries
1 cup chopped mango
1 tsp. grated ginger (grated with a microplane)
1/4 tsp. black pepper
Pinch sea salt
Directions
Step 1 – Chop all ingredients to the consistency you like.
Step 2 – Mix in a medium mixing bowl.
Step 3 – Chill and serve with organic corn chips.

Nutritional Content
1 serving = 1/2 cup
Calories: 49
Total Fat: 0 gm
Saturated Fats: 0 gm
Trans Fats: 0 gm
Cholesterol: 0 mg
Sodium: 1 mg
Carbohydrates: 13 gm
Dietary fiber: 2 gm
Sugars: 10 gm
Protein: 1 gm
Estimated Glycemic Load: 4
Nutritional Information estimated at Nutritiondata.com. Data may not be accurate.
